"Extremely Disappointed with Chimcare’s Service and Product, go with someone else! Our experience with Chimcare started off positively—they did a great job removing a large chimney from our house and installing a gas fireplace insert. Unfortunately, everything went downhill after that. The gas insert they sold us, a Regency brand, has been nothing but a nightmare. Over the last three years, we’ve had to call Chimcare out to repair it at least eight times. Each time, the fireplace works for only a couple of weeks—or less—before breaking down again, often in the same way. Most recently, the ceramic insert they installed broke after just a few days of intermittent use. This strongly suggests that their technicians are not properly trained at installing the ceramic inserts, leading to repeated failures. Because of these issues, we’ve had a functional fireplace for only two months total over the last two years. This failure to provide a reliable product and service has significantly impacted our family. We’ve gone through two Thanksgivings and two Christmases without a working fireplace. To make matters worse, during the major ice storm last year, we were left without the heat the fireplace could have provided—something we should have been able to rely on to keep our home and two small children warm during a power outage. Despite our repeated requests, Chimcare has been incredibly unhelpful in resolving the situation. I’ve had to pester them with calls every few days to get any progress on having Regency honor the warranty. They are completely unresponsive/not-proactive unless I am calling them directly - technician, project planner, and front office are all favorites in my phone - at this point, I’ve had to call daily just to get any updates or action on what should be a simple warranty replacement. Their lack of proactivity and accountability has been exhausting and deeply disappointing and makes it seem like they are not actually trying to honor my warranty and for what we paid for in terms of service. It’s incredibly frustrating to have spent so much money on this installation, only to deal with constant repairs, an unusable product, and a company that refuses to address their technician’s clear errors. While their team is polite when scheduling repairs and when the technicians are present, politeness doesn’t make up for poor service and unreliability. We deeply regret choosing Chimcare for our fireplace installation and strongly advise others to look elsewhere for their fireplace needs."

Gas log services FAQs

A gas log fireplace should be inspected and serviced as needed once a year. Preventative maintenance can help keep your fireplace in working condition and save money in the long run by avoiding more costly repairs on parts that could have been fixed sooner with a regular inspection.

The cost difference between a gas fireplace and a wood-burning fireplace depends on the type of wood-burning fireplace installed. The cost to install a gas fireplace tends to be cheaper than the cost to install a brick wood-burning fireplace. Installing a gas fireplace costs about $3,600 on average, whereas the cost to build a masonry wood-burning fireplace can go up to $30,000. The cost to install a wood-burning fireplace insert or stove can cost from $700 to $6,500, about the same as a gas fireplace on average.

The cost to repair a fireplace depends on the type, extent of repairs needed, and your location. The average cost to repair a fireplace varies depending on the part of the fireplace that needs work:

  • Firebox: $160–$2,500

  • Refractory panel: $200–$300

  • Hearth: $150–$800

  • Mantel: $500–$1,200

  • Pilot light: $100–$350

  • Igniter: $100–$150

  • Gas valve: $150–$300

  • Thermocouple: $75–$350

  • Thermopile: $75–$350

Yes, it can be worth installing a gas fireplace, depending on your home heating needs. The cost to install a gas fireplace can be much lower than the cost to install a comparable wood-burning fireplace. The convenience of starting a fire with the flip of a switch and turning it off just as quickly makes a gas fireplace a big time saver over starting and maintaining a wood-fueled fire. A gas fireplace also does not require ash cleanup or frequent chimney cleaning to remove creosote and other buildup that can lead to chimney fires. Gas fireplaces burn and heat much more cleanly than wood fireplaces.

A gas fireplace insert costs about $3,600 to install, on average. The cost to install a gas log insert ranges from about $700 to $6,500, depending on the size, type of insert, how it works, and heating needs. Gas fireplaces need electrical and gas lines installed properly, so hiring a pro is recommended rather than trying to DIY installation.
